Why is Ro wearing Kira’s d’ja pagh? Seriously, that image at the end is Kira’s.
This is Kira wearing the d’ja pagh.

Here is Ro in “Ensign Ro”.

This is the d’ja pagh Ro gives Picard in “Impostors”.

EDIT: If you think it’s just a common design, it isn’t. While in the context of DS9’s present day, Bajorans wear the d’ja pagh as a sign of piety that used to represent one’s family. Plus we’ve seen individuals like Li Nalas be identified by their d’ja pagh alone. “Accession” mentions that whole families are identified by their design which also indicates what trade they are in as part of the caste system of older times.
EDIT 2: That image also shows the d’ja pagh on the right ear. It was established that Ro wasn’t spiritual, and thus wore her’s on the left ear to stop people from feeling her pagh.
